lsinv

The lsinv.sh bash-script allows on linux machines running an avahi-daemon and having avahi-utils installed to list all available ITxPT inventory services. The default output is generated as a JSON array.

Prerequisits

  • The following tools need to be installed:

    • avahi-daemon

    • avahi-utils (for avahi-browse)

    • grepcidr

    • jq

  • avahi-daemon disable for IPv6

If you don’t already have a folder for github repos, Create one.. Ex:

sudo mkdir /opt/git

Then move into that folder

cd /opt/git

Then from there clone the lsinv repo

sudo git clone https://github.com/ITxPT/lsinv.git

This will create a subfolder named lsinv, move into that folder..

cd lsinv

_Note:_To make the script available as bash command use a symbolic link. Within the repository folder execute the following command:

sudo ln -s $(pwd)/lsinv.sh /usr/local/bin/lsinv

Usage

Download repository and use tool directly from installation folder or copy /usr/local/bin:

./lsinv.sh  -i 192.168.1.0/24

Known issues

  • Due to optional fields and the fact that JSON allows unsorted fields the CSV output is unreliable
